The park serves as the geometric center of El Rosal, located at the intersection of the primary urban grids.
The surrounding municipality of El Rosal is historically significant for its agricultural output, particularly in flower cultivation, which is reflected in the floral displays within the park.
The site hosts the town's traditional holiday festivities, including the Christmas light displays that are a focal point for the regional community.
El Rosal Main Park, locally known as Parque Principal de El Rosal, serves as the central social and civic hub of the municipality of El Rosal, Cundinamarca. The park features a traditional design centered around a central fountain and paved walkways, reflecting the colonial layout common to small Colombian towns. It is surrounded by the municipal administrative buildings and the local parish church, anchoring the town’s architectural layout. The park functions as a primary gathering space for community events, local festivals, and informal daily relaxation. It is elevated within the Cundinamarca highlands, characterized by a cool, temperate climate. The site is meticulously maintained with manicured gardens and frequent tree pruning to preserve visibility and safety.
